Would You Expect Anything Less

"WOULD YOU EXPECT ANYTHING LESS?" in these nights of submission when the Pacific soothes my pain when my throat and lungs die the numbers on my Casio laugh showing their stubbornness to keep going no matter the wrist it rests on. in these nights of silence when I'm alone with my thoughts and the hatred and laughs of many live I have the one thing no one can take from me: I'm Chicano Eddie and I'd do it all over again. By: Chicano Eddie 3252017
